JNS.org – Following the signing of a unity agreement between Palestinian Authority President Mahmoud Abbas’s Fatah party and the Gaza-based terror group Hamas on Wednesday, five Qassam rockets were launched from Gaza toward Israel, with four failing to reach Israeli territory and the fifth exploding near the Israel-Gaza border fence.
Also on Wednesday, the Israel Defense Forces said it carried out a “counterterrorism operation” in northern Gaza, but that “a hit was not identified.”
“We don’t always hit the target, it happens,” an Israeli security official told Israel Hayom. “But in a vast majority of cases, we hit [the target].”
